"Tonight we are going to recognize the second highest lever of advancement in Cub Scouts: The Webelos Advancement. The highest achievement is the Arrow of Light, before they cross over to Boy Scouts. (that is if they survive tonight)."
"Would the following boys please come up and join us around the campfire with your parents behind you."
"We know that all of these boys have earned at least 3 activity pins, know the meaning of the Webelos Badge, lead flag ceremonies, know and understand the requirements to become a Boy Scout, and have completed their religious requirements. We are proud of their efforts but felt that they should probably have to pass the same test that the young Zulu boys had to pass in order to become Zulu scouts and warriors before they are given their badges."
"Let me tell you that story: Drum beat, please."
"When a Zulu boy was old enough to become a warrior, he was taken out in the woods, stripped of his clothes (pause) and covered in white paint. He was given only a small spear and shield with which he could kill small animals and provide himself a little protection. He was then left in the woods."
"Anyone seeing the boy while he was painted would hunt him down. It took about a month for the white paint to wear off his body. So for about a month the boy would have to hide in the brush and live as well as he could. he had to follow the tracks of the deer and creep near enough to animals to spear them just so he could eat and make clothes for himself. He had to be able t run long distances, climb trees and swim rivers in order to escape his pursuers. He had to be brave. Only the best among these boys would pass the test."
"After a month, when the white paint had worn off, if he survived he would be welcomed home to his tribe."
"We have a bucket of white paint here, and a spear and shield for each of you. Who would like to go first?" (Arrange set up with curtain, throw clothes over, dump white "paint".)
"We decided that you would probably get picked up by the police if you were running around naked and painted white, so we will accept the work you have done to become Webelos and paint you faces white instead."
Call names.
"As your chief, I am honored to bestow upon you the Badge of Webelos which you have rightfully earned."
